A bit about this role: 

Devoted Health’s Risk Adjustment team is entrusted with securing and submitting the revenue of our plan in order to fund the care that we provide to our members. Our work directly enables better care and better benefits for our members, and our team is an exemplar of hyper-compliance with our regulators.

Our team includes three functions that collectively work to ensure the complete and accurate submission of diagnosis data to CMS:

Risk Adjustment Provider Program: supports our provider partners with the data, education, and infrastructure needed to accurately and completely document our members’ true conditions at the point of care

Risk Adjustment Retrospective Program: retrieves and reviews medical documentation for historical dates of service to ensure the accurate and complete documentation of our members’ true conditions after the point of care

Risk Adjustment Program Integrity: ensures the integrity of our risk adjustment programs through the complete and timely submission of data to CMS and through a highly active auditing program
